Stop allowing kids to go to school with lice! Or bring back lice checks at school!

The Issue

In my 23 years of living I never before had to deal with a lice situation. Recently my son came home infested with them, I later found out that it came from school. They said they sent out letters to inform parents but I never received that letter. I discovered the lice on his head on my own because I noticed that he began to scratch his head a lot. I then also found them in my head & in my other 2 kids heads as well. I had to pay over $300 to get rid of this infestation. I’m not sure how these parents are able to afford these treatments but I barely make it through with the little bit of money I have, because I had to pay over $300 to get rid of the infestation the first time back in December of 2022 I got backed up on not just my rent but also my bills. Now here we are April 19 of 2023 & I’m just now catching up on all of my payments just to find out that my son has lice AGAIN! His birthday just passed (April 13th) & I wasn’t able to do much due to me trying to get caught up on everything else. Now I have to figure out how I’m going to get rid of these lice on our heads for the second time. My son already has to deal with all these other issues he has with his health & mental, & now this. I try my hardest to keep my kids safe, healthy, & out the way of others, we don’t go out much & I don’t have them around other kids to prevent them from getting sick or stuff like this from happening. I of course let my kids play outside & sometimes with family members but we’ve never before had any lice issues. For him to be in a special education school he should not be coming home with lice, it not only distracts him but it also causes emotional distress. It’s so hard for me to have to sit him down & search his head for lice & do these treatments on him to get rid of them when he barely even lets me touch his hair. Not only is it physically hard to keep him in a chair to search his head or even to treat him but it’s also emotionally hard to watch my son cry & scream all because the school system has become so irresponsible with situations like these. When I brought it up to the school district they said that I have to contact the state about this because it became a law that kids can’t be kept home because of lice, & that there’s nothing they can do. So now here I am trying to make a change because this is not fair at all especially when I (just like any good parent out there) try my best to keep my kids safe & healthy just to send him to school to get infested with lice & come home & infest not just his siblings but also myself & anyone else we may come around because that’s how easily they can spread. My son once had long beautiful curly hair but we unfortunately had to cut it all off because it began to grow uneven & it also started to lock up in certain areas & it was hard for us to untangle it because he wouldn’t really let us touch it. Since then I’ve been letting it grow , but now I’m afraid I’ll have to cut it again because this is the second time he comes home with lice & he will not let us treat him without having to struggle with him from him kicking & screaming because he doesn’t want to be bothered. At this point I will not rest until these kids get some justice. It is not fair not just to us parents but to these children as well. If this continues it can begin to spread & it will never end, remember that it takes just 1 that can turn into 50 in just one persons head. & they’re so easy to spread you can literally sit next to a person & they can get right in your hair. Back in the days schools had Drs come search kids heads at schools & do treatments on them or they wouldn’t let a kid back in school until they’ve treated the lice infestation. Now they just don’t care about it anymore & they’ve left us to deal with it on our own & that is not right! Something MUST be done & we can all make a change by standing up & standing on what we believe in!
